10.6 ns propagation delay — timing margin on the bus
At 5V with a 50 pF load, the SN74LV14AD delivers a maximum propagation delay of 10.6 ns. That is fast enough for most 20–50 MHz clock-domain handshakes but not a contender for high-speed serial links. The 74LV family sits between the original 74HC (slower, higher current) and the 74AHC (faster, lower power). If your bus needs sub-7 ns delay, the 74LVU04 variant (SN74LVU04APWT) offers 7 ns at 5V/50pF but lacks Schmitt-trigger inputs — you trade noise immunity for speed.
Active lifecycle, no LTB pressure
The SN74LV14AD carries an Active lifecycle status. No last-time-buy notices are in the public record. The part is ROHS3 compliant. For a BOM line that needs a standard logic gate with Schmitt-trigger inputs, this is a low-risk choice for both prototype and production runs.
